Shirtwaist dress pattern offers smartness and versatility

The pattern 9942 presents a shirtwaist dress suitable for sports, office, and street wear in pin striped, checked, silk, or plain fabrics. It features a box plaited skirt, short sleeves, and long sleeves with a diagrammed sew chart. Story of silver through ages and world nations

A sweeping look at silver's long history from ancient tableware to noble regalia, noting Greek spoons, the Apostle spoons, and evolving knives and forks. It traces silversmiths in Newburyport, colonial craft, Mexican and Peruvian silver influence, and modern makers like Gorham and Tiffany while highlighting cultural uses from Malay betrothal cups to Moorish and Indian traditions.
